HawksBeerFan

Registered User
Nov 9, 2014
5,667
2,515
because it’s a museum
Having been there it's a bit of both.

There's a ton of exhibits about the game itself and the players who played the game. There's also the "hall" portion where there are a bunch of plaques of those inducted to the hall of fame.

I don't see any reason why steroid users and douchebags should be excluded from the exhibit portion. That part of the museum is about the history of the game. It probably even makes sense to have a specific area devoted to the steroid area.

That's different than honoring an individual player who cheated with a plaque that identifies them as a uniquely great player in the history of the game.
